There are two different engines for the 1999 Mazda 626. The 2.0L L4 engine specifies have a .044-inch gap. The 2.5L V6 has a gap of .032 or .044 depending on the type and brand of spark plug (platinum vs. iridium). Most modern plugs for this application are pre-gapped and no further adjustments are needed.
